What are the codes for the safety deposit room Resident Evil 2?

The list of items and their respective numbers are:

  • 102 – Gunpowder.
  • 103 – Combat Knife.
  • 106 – Film: “Commemorative” (Commemorative Photo)
  • 109 – Handgun Ammo [1st] / Large-caliber Handgun Ammo [2nd]
  • 203 – Hip Pouch.
  • 208 – Shotgun Shells (Leon) / Flame Rounds (Claire)

Where is the battery re3 Carlos?

The battery itself is in the Safety Deposit Room downstairs, held inside one of the sealed deposit boxes. However, the room itself is locked and requires a key to open.

Did Nikolai survive Re3?

Three accounts claim he made his escape attempt at Incineration Disposal Plant P-12A. In one of them, he was immediately killed by Nemesis-T Type. In the second, he commandeered a helicopter and was killed in battle with Valentine. In the third, he escaped in the helicopter.

What was cut from Resident Evil 3 remake?

Apart from locations, several enemies were also cut in Resident Evil 3 remake. Unfortunately for fans, the removal of the graveyard in the remake also meant that the famous Grave Digger has been cut from the game.
